Audio Processing and the Whisper Model

To provide transcription services, your Audio Files are securely uploaded to our servers.

We use OpenAI's Whisper model, an advanced AI speech recognition technology, running on our own backend infrastructure to process your audio and generate transcripts. The Whisper model we use is operated under the terms of its MIT license.

Importantly, your audio data is NOT sent to OpenAI or any other third-party transcription service provider for processing. We manage the entire transcription process on servers we control.
